Starting Point: Quai Laubeuf

The tour kicks off here, a scenic spot that gives a gentle introduction to Cannes’s waterfront vibe. Your guide, whose name may be shared upon booking, will meet you here, ready with a friendly greeting and a plan for the next 2.5 hours.

Quai Saint-Pierre (18 minutes)

This spot offers a glimpse of Cannes’s maritime history. Expect to hear stories about the city’s roots as a humble fishing hamlet, which is a compelling contrast to its current cinematic fame. The proximity to the port means you’ll likely enjoy views of boats bobbing in the water, setting a relaxing tone for the walk.

Rue du Suquet (18 minutes)

Next, a stroll through one of Cannes’s oldest neighborhoods, with cobbled streets and charming buildings. This area is often described as a “little piece of old-world France,” and will give you a feel for what Cannes looked like before the glamour. Expect narrow alleyways, local cafes, and colorful architecture, perfect for those wanting to see more than just the glossy surface.

Marché Forville (18 minutes)

A highlight of the tour, this vibrant market is a feast for the senses. Here, fresh produce, flowers, and local specialties create a lively atmosphere. Reviewers mention the market’s recent renovations, which have enhanced its lively charm. It’s the perfect place to soak in the daily hustle of Cannes life and perhaps pick up a snack or souvenir.

Rue Meynadier (18 minutes)

This pedestrian street is packed with shops, cafes, and a lively local vibe. It’s a great spot to observe everyday life in Cannes and see how residents and visitors mingle. The street’s history as a commercial hub means it’s full of character, buzzing with energy.

Rue Félix Faure (18 minutes)

Another charming street that leads toward the Palais des Festivals, offering a glimpse into the city’s bustling commercial core. This stretch is perfect for people-watching and imagining the Hollywood stars walking these same streets during the festival.

Palais des Festivals (18 minutes)

No visit to Cannes is complete without seeing the iconic Palais des Festivals. Your guide will share stories about the famous festival, its history, and the celebrities who have graced its steps. Expect to hear anecdotes about the red carpet and the festival’s role in shaping Cannes’s identity as a global cultural hub.

Croisette Beach Cannes (19 minutes)

Finally, you’ll stroll along La Croisette, Cannes’s most famous boulevard, lined with luxury hotels, designer boutiques, and stunning sea views. Many reviews mention feeling like they’ve stepped into a movie scene—expect plenty of photo opportunities here. The walk ends near the beach, where you can relax or continue exploring on your own.
